Adopting PR, Podcasts, SEO and AI Visibility to Build Brand Authority

1. Press Releases: The Engine of Brand Authority 

At its core, the strategic press release remains a crucial tool to build brand authority by transforming company updates into newsworthy milestones. When your brand’s achievements are picked up by reputable news wires and trade publications, it provides a layer of institutional “proof” that marketing alone cannot buy. This isn’t just about announcing a new hire or a product launch; it’s about crafting a narrative of momentum and industry leadership. 

A well-distributed press release builds brand authority by creating a permanent, searchable record of your company’s growth and expertise. Unlike social media posts that disappear in a feed, a press release indexed by major search engines acts as a credible anchor for your digital footprint. For a more effective distribution strategy, think beyond the standard “announcement” and consider data-driven reports, community impact initiatives, and pioneering research findings. This ensures that when stakeholders perform due diligence on your brand, they encounter a history of professional excellence validated by independent journalistic standards. 

2. Podcasts: The Intimate Connection 

While PR provides broad validation, podcasts seek to establish an intimate and direct bond with your audience. In an audio-first world, these long-form, niche-specific talks help to build brand authority and trust amongst listeners. Whether you host your own podcast, appear as a guest on industry-relevant shows, or sponsor popular programs, the medium fosters a unique level of trust. 

Unlike fleeting social media posts, podcast listeners often dedicate significant time to an episode, absorbing information while commuting, exercising, or performing household tasks. When you share insights, tell stories, and engage in authentic conversations, you position yourself as a humanized, approachable authority. Furthermore, podcast content is evergreen; a well-produced episode can continue to attract new listeners and build trust for months or even years. It’s also a powerful tool for repurposing content, generating snippets for social media, and transcribing for SEO benefits. 

3. Search Engine Optimization (SEO): The Pathway to Discovery 

No matter how credible your PR or how engaging your podcast, if people can’t find you, your efforts are diminished. This is where SEO steps in as the crucial pathway to discovery and ongoing trust-building. SEO ensures that when potential customers search for solutions, information, or even reviews related to your industry, your brand appears prominently. 

Modern SEO is far more sophisticated than keyword stuffing. It’s about providing genuine value, demonstrating expertise, experience, authoritativeness, and trustworthiness (E-E-A-T) – concepts that Google heavily prioritizes. This means you naturally build brand authority by creating high-quality, relevant content that answers user questions, optimizing your website for user experience, ensuring mobile responsiveness, and building a robust backlink profile from reputable sources. Effective SEO ensures that when curiosity strikes, your brand is the reliable answer, reinforcing the trust cultivated through PR and podcasts. 

4. AI Visibility: The Future of Trust and Discovery 

The newest and rapidly evolving layer of the Trust Stack is AI Visibility. As AI-powered tools like ChatGPT, Bard, and other large language models (LLMs) become primary sources of information for consumers, brands need to adapt. How will your brand be represented when an AI is asked about your industry, your products, or your solutions? 

AI models learn from the vast ocean of data available online. This means that strong PR, comprehensive SEO, and rich, expert-driven podcast content are now critical inputs for shaping how AI “understands” and articulates your brand’s value. If your brand consistently appears in credible news sources, is discussed by authorities in podcasts, and ranks highly for relevant search queries, AI is more likely to retrieve and synthesize positive, accurate information about you. 

To build brand authority for AI visibility, you need to ensure your content is clear, factual, well-structured, and provides definitive answers to common questions. It’s about being present and authoritative across all digital touchpoints so that when an AI summarizes information, your brand is presented as a trusted, knowledgeable entity. This isn’t just about being found on Google, it’s more about being recognized and recommended by the intelligent agents that are increasingly guiding human decisions.

Best practices for Localized SEO for LLMs 

Getting noticed by AI isn’t just about keywords anymore. LLMs look for businesses that show real, local expertise and make it easy to find accurate information. The following strategies can help your business stand out and become the go-to answer in your area: 

1. Build Content Around Localized Experience 

LLMs prioritize “real-world” signals. Instead of just stating facts, provide content that proves you operate in a specific physical area. Use specific landmarks, local jargon, and neighborhood-specific advice. 

  • Example: If you are a plumber in Austin, don’t just write “We fix pipes in Austin.” Write a guide on “How Austin’s hard water affects pipes in the Travis Heights neighborhood” and mention local water treatment standards. 
  • Why it works: It provides “unique data points” that the LLM can use to distinguish you from generic national competitors. 

2. Use Clear Headings and FAQs 

LLMs are “pattern hunters.” They scan your page for direct answers to user prompts. Structured headings (H2, H3) and FAQ sections act as a map, making it easy for the AI to “clip” your answer and credit you as the source. 

  • Example: Instead of a heading like “Our Rates,” use “How much does a window cleaning service cost in Seattle?” Follow it with a 2–3 sentence direct answer. 
  • Why it works: This matches the conversational way people ask AI questions (e.g., “Hey Gemini, how much for a window cleaner in Seattle?”). 

3. Maintain Consistency Across Platforms 

LLMs don’t just look at your website; they “read” the whole internet. Your NAP (Name, Address, Phone Number) must be identical on your website, Google Business Profile, Yelp, Apple Maps, and social media. 

  • Example: If your address is “123 Main St., Suite 4,” don’t write it as “123 Main Street #4” on Facebook. Keep the format exactly the same everywhere. 
  • Why it works: Consistency creates a “strong entity.” If the AI sees the same info 10 times, it treats it as a “fact.” If it sees conflicting info, it may ignore you to avoid giving the user a wrong address. 

4. Internal Linking 

Think of internal links as “vouching” for your own pages. In localized SEO, you should link your general service pages to your specific location pages and vice versa. 

  • Example: On your “Home Security Systems” page, include a link that says: “See our specific security recommendations for Downtown Miami residents.” 
  • Why it works: It helps the LLM understand the relationship between your services and your geography. It builds a “cluster” of authority that tells the AI you are the go-to expert for that topic in that area.

Make Sure Your Website Can Handle Holiday Traffic 

What many businesses overlook is that more traffic needs more server power. The hosting plan that works fine in July may not survive the surge in November and December. 

This is where scalable hosting becomes your best friend. Many hosting providers can automatically boost your server capacity whenever traffic spikes, keeping your site fast and stable. You only pay extra during those high-traffic moments — not the whole year. 

If you expect more shoppers this holiday season, upgrading to scalable hosting is one of the smartest ways to stay ahead and protect your sales.

Keep Your Website Protected 

With increased holiday activity, website security must be a top priority in your holiday website maintenance checklist.
Implement a Web Application Firewall and maintain regular backups to safeguard data. Restrict unauthorized file uploads and ensure your hosting provider offers robust protection. 
Keep antivirus tools and software updated, use HTTPS for encrypted connections, and install reputable security plugins to strengthen overall defense. 

A secure site not only prevents threats but also builds user trust and business credibility.

Must-Know Consumer Behaviors for BFCM 2025 

In 2025, consumers are smarter and more selective than ever. Gone are the days when a generic discount or a flashy banner could guarantee attention. Today shoppers are strategic—they research, compare, and only click “buy” when the value is undeniable. Here’s what you need to know about consumer behavior before implementing BFCM 2025 marketing strategies: 

  • Research-Driven Shoppers: Shoppers no longer rely on impulse. They compare prices, read reviews, and check multiple stores before committing. Brands that make information accessible and transparent gain an edge. 
  • Story-Seeking Buyers: Shoppers want to know the “why” behind a product. They look for product origins, real-life impact, and the story behind the brand before deciding. Clear storytelling influences trust and buying decisions. 
  • FOMO & Limited-Time Urgency: Scarcity drives action. Limited stock, countdown timers, and early-bird offers create urgency and push faster purchasing decisions.  
  • Visual & Interactive Engagement: Product videos, AR try-ons, and interactive demos capture attention more effectively than static images, boosting engagement and conversions.  
  • Loyalty & Subscriptions: Repeat buyers seek rewards, early access, and exclusive member offers. Rewarding loyalty increases retention and repeat sales. 
  • Experience-First Shopping: Shoppers value convenience, speed, and smooth interactions. Easy navigation and reliable delivery boost satisfaction and purchases. 
  • Feedback Sensitivity: Shoppers expect quick responses to questions and issues. Brands that respond in real time build trust and encourage repeat business. 
  • Retention-Driven Behavior: After BFCM, shoppers notice which brands stay in touch. Useful updates, simple guidance, and small perks make them more likely to return.
